If you're making a trip to the west side of the mitt to see the beautiful fall colors, plan on making a stop just north of Ludington for this one-of-a-kind haunted attraction.

Camp Sauble is an abandoned prison; it opened in 1960 and transformed into a boot camp for four years in the late 80's. After that, to save money, it was changed into a minimum security prison. It was closed in 2005 and sold to Free Soil Township for $1.

This year, it's being used as a haunted house called Cages of Carnage. It's located at 4058 E. Free Soil Road in Free Soil Township and open from 7-11 p.m. on Fridays and Saturdays, Oct. 18, 19, 25 and 26th.
